Output 8f43b1750a706833d901fe6d349309ce9d1bd113135bb2f743fd9c167942917a:6

value
321703844
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 498d01f82f49642804e0a90f2e33172e55e86066 OP_EQUALVERIFY OP_CHECKSIG
address
17huFPceah4uTeiLV5xjeFX37SFoZZv6Np
transaction
8f43b1750a706833d901fe6d349309ce9d1bd113135bb2f743fd9c167942917a
spent
true